I'm an ele and would really like to try this out. The only problem is that I'm not very experienced in the uw, so finding a group is near impossible. I'm sure with a little direction and explanations I could run the build just fine.
Don't join speed clear groups if you are not experienced with an area!! Learning will be difficult for you in a speed clear situation, and everyone else will be pissed at you because you'll be slowing everything down, if not making the group fail entirely!
You should first familiarize yourself with areas like UW doing what they call "old school" clears, in normal mode. As an elementalist, it is really easy to find such groups since most people want nukers for damage. When you've learnt about the area, know what all quests trigger and how they should be completed, then you can think of joining speed clear groups.

Something I noticed playing pits for the first time.

If you kill the collector(or the trasher, dont remember what kind) with a minion, the AI will target the masterless minion with lingering curse, and FoC hitting you too. (or worse if you are near a dryder fireball and meteor).

So a little precaution on the killing order is needed.

Also, i wasn't able to dead charge up hill, so I ran troughs the big grp of 4 skele. With speedbost and dead charge i lost the aggro easy, but there is any way to avoid it?
